In addition, the Government provides significant contributions to and works in partnership with a number
of key organizations:
The Canadian Race Relations Foundation is a national centre of expertise and an
active promoter of anti-racism issues in Canada. In 2011, the Foundation created a
nation-wide interfaith. network that will serve as a forum for promoting inter-religious
discussion.
- The Government of Canada also partners with the Aga Khan to create the Global Center for Pluralism
in Ottawa, with a goal of advancing openness to diversity and promote mutual understanding between
communities internationally.
In 2013, Canada will Chair the Task Force for International Cooperation on
Holocaust Education, Remembrance, and Research.
